Dell Unity™ Family Unisphere® Command Line Interface User Guide

Delete NFS network shares

Delete an NFS share.

Format

/stor/prov/fs/nfs {-id <value> | -name <value>} delete [-async]

Object qualifiers

QualifierDescription
-idType the ID of an NFS share to change. View NFS share settings explains how to view the IDs of the NFS network shares on the system.
-nameType the name of an NFS share to change.

Action qualifier

QualifierDescription
-asyncRun the operation in asynchronous mode.

Example

The following command deletes NFS share NFSShare_1:

uemcli -d 10.0.0.1 -u Local/joe -p MyPassword456! /stor/prov/fs/nfs –id NFSShare_1 delete
Storage system address: 10.0.0.1
Storage system port: 443
HTTPS connection

Operation completed successfully.
